Abstract
The invention discloses the interface circuit of voice recorder, it is characterised in that:Including socket, loudspeaker, double control switch K, bridge rectifier diode D, voltage-regulator diode D1, resistance R2, R3, R4, R5, electric capacity C1, C2, C3, C4, triode T1 and T2, the port 1 of port 1 and bridge rectifier diode D on the socket connects, the port 3 of port 2 and bridge rectifier diode D on socket connects, bridge rectifier diode D port 2 is sequentially connected in series electric capacity C2 and double control switch K not moved end C, bridge rectifier diode D port 4 is sequentially connected in series resistance R3, triode T1 emitter stage, triode T1 colelctor electrode, triode T2 colelctor electrode, triode T2 emitter stage and resistance R2, resistance R2 is also connected with bridge rectifier diode D port 2;I/O port 1 on described double control switch K moved end a connection loudspeaker, the I/O port 2 on double control switch K not moved end b connection loudspeaker, the I/O port 3 on loudspeaker connect electric capacity C1.For the present invention by above-mentioned principle, circuit reliability is high, and price is low, is alternatively arranged as the interface circuit of automatic telephone inquiry or telephone dialing control system, using flexible.

Background technology
With digital signal processing chip (DSP) development, encoding and decoding speech technology is increasingly applied to the military, people
With with monitoring etc. field.For speech digit recorder, transport, public security, fire-fighting, telephone service matter also can be widely used in
The numerous areas such as amount supervision.But recorder is generally positioned near working site, if it is to be understood that the working condition of recorder
Or inquiry record data therein, attendant must arrive scene, workload is very big.Recorder can provide long-range phone and look into
Interface is ask, attendant relies on the working condition and data record of the phone can inquiry recorder in hand.System needs only
A telephone number is accounted for, user inputs password under voice message by telephone keypad after connecting phone, can after confirmation
It is whether normal to inquire about the working condition of recorder.The one section of voice that can also be stored to recorder input time is inquired about,
Voice record will play via telephone line.Wherein need to use the high and flexible interface circuit of reliability, and existing electricity
Road can not meet needs.

The input exchange signal transmitted for signal input part enters bridge rectifier after first passing through electric capacity C3 filter action
Diode D powers to socket again after AC signal is converted into direct current signal, is used for external electric equipment.Input friendship simultaneously
Signal is flowed after electric capacity C3 filtering, and triode T1 emitter stage is entered after resistance R3 partial pressure;Input exchange signal
The input triode T1 base stage after electric capacity C3 and electric capacity C4 filter action, and voltage-regulator diode D1 setting, then avoid
Ac input signal is directly entered triode T1 and T2 colelctor electrode, damages triode.This circuit passes through a current source simultaneously
Break-make is realized, is provided with interchanger on double control switch K not moved end C, interchanger is sentenced by the DC current on circuit
Disconnected user's plucks receiver-on-hook condition.Resistance R3, R4 and R5 are then to be used for partial pressure, protection triode T1 and T2.When control signal end is
During low level, triode T2 cut-offs, electric current is smaller, in hook state;When control signal end is high level, triode T2 is led
Logical, triode T1 and T2 composition electric current, electric current is larger, and now loudspeaker send sound, phone off-hook, and double control switch K moved end connects
It is connected on not on the C of moved end, loudspeaker stop sounding, are in the double control switch interchanger that moved end C is not set and connect speech channel state.
Output signal on recorder is passed through electricity by this circuit by the way of direct capacitance coupling compared with prior art
Hold C2 and resistance R2 sound is coupled on telephone line, eliminate extra electronic component interference, signal transmission is more stable
Reliably, the circuit reliability it is high, it is cheap and can as automatic telephone inquire about or telephone dialing control system interface electricity
Road, using flexible.Bridging piezo-resistance R1 in addition, has the function that protection against lightning strikes.
